The best investors for distressed properties are those people with the time and ability to research all the issues related to making an informed decision. At some point you can make the decision to hire professionals to give you the final go ahead. Before you spend the money, however, you want to be reasonably certain there will be no surprise repairs, no overly expensive waste cleanup, and no creditor claims that will still be good even after you buy a property. Having a talent for research and knowing where to look for information is not very common among the general population. If you can do the research, and if you enjoy doing it in pursuit of a goal, then you will find yourself with not very much competition as you hunt for investments in distressed properties.
Investing in these properties also requires a certain amount of self-confidence and the disregard of other people's opinions. You cannot be frightened away by a stigma property, for example, just because everyone thinks it is a bad investment. If you are the kind of person who is sure when you are right, with no second guessing, you will do well. If you are often overcome with doubt, especially when other people contradict you, you might not be emotionally suited to this strategy.
Here is the trick about these properties: Most people who know about looming crises - lawyers, doctors, counselors, and religious leaders - are not allowed to tell anyone. Even if you found out, would you really feel comfortable intruding on someone's problems and offering to buy their property cheaply? Most people cannot do this.
Instead, network with the lawyers, doctors, counselors, and religious leaders. Let them know you are prepared to buy properties quickly, with little notice. Make sure they know you buy at discounted prices, but you can close quickly. Leave business cards that include the legend, "I buy properties quickly and quietly."
Many people spend a minimal amount - US Dollars 100 or so - on signs to plaster everywhere. They say something along the lines of: "Problems? We buy properties quickly and quietly. Call 555-0000." I am not convinced this is an effective strategy, because you are shot-gunning such a large audience. I prefer more targeted advertising, such as an advertisement in the "Want to Buy" classified section of the local newspaper, signs at pawn shops, and a website with good placement when someone searches on "quick cash and [the name of your community]."
